About the CATALINA MORGAN 440
Maximum Draft: 5.75'/1.75m. Renamed the Catalina 440 in 2010.
Designed by Gerry Douglas and built by Catalina Yachts (USA) from 2004–2012, the Catalina Morgan 440 is a substantial cruising sloop with a displacement of 25528.0 lb and a beam of 14.0 ft. While the exact hulls built count is unspecified in the source data, the model is characterized by its comfortable interior and robust construction, though owners report significant maintenance challenges.
- Best for:
- This boat suits coastal cruisers and those seeking a spacious, stable platform for family cruising, provided they are prepared for rigorous maintenance of structural components. It is less ideal for single-handers due to its size and weight, but appeals to couples or families prioritizing interior volume and comfort over high-performance racing.
- Bluewater capability:
- With a displacement of 25528.0 lb, a capsize ratio of 1.91, and a fin keel, the boat possesses the stability and mass for offshore passages, but critical structural issues like deck core moisture and keel cracking must be resolved before considering bluewater use.
- Comparables:
- Comparable boats include the Beneteau 46 and Hunter 44, which offer similar interior volumes and cruising comfort from the same era. The Morgan 440 distinguishes itself with a heavier displacement (25528.0 lb) and a more traditional cruising layout compared to the lighter, performance-oriented designs of some contemporaries.
